Opinion
The motion of the appellee to dismiss the appeal is granted and the appeal is dismissed (1) for the want of a final judgment, Bosttwick v. Brinkerhoff, 106 U. S. 3; Cotton v. Hawaii, 211 U. S. 162, 170; Georgia Ry. Co. v. Decatur, 262 U. S. 432, 437; (2) for the want of a substantial federal question, Phelps v. Board of Education, 300 U. S. 319; Dodge v. Board of Education, 302 U. S. 74.
